    One common compliant we hear about DEI is, “You’re trying to have diversity quotas. Why can’t we just hire the best people? “We’re lowering the standards, so now we don’t have quality products.” Well, we should hire the best people. But part of hiring the best people is having a wide candidate pool, which you can only get from diverse sources.
What we’re trying to do is win at work. So yes, DEI does introduce more competition, but really that’s what’s best for business.
